Twins Sink Vikings
Twins Sink Vikings

The Columbia-Greene CC men's basketball team hosted Hudson Valley CC in a Region 3 match-up tonight, winning 86-68.

In the first half, the Twins were led by Tydrea Rodriguez and Sawyer Spohler who each scored 12 points and 10 points respectively.  C-GCC ended the half on a 6-0 run to take a 37-31 advantage going into the break. "In the first half, I thought we were going a little too fast on offense.  We were not letting the offense work," said head coach Walter Rickard.  "We were taking shots a little too quick in our half court offense."

The second half was a different story.  Right from the inbounds to start the half, the Twins go off to a hot start.  The lead was pushed to 19 points within the first four minutes with great defense and converting turnovers into points.  But the Vikings would not go away.  They went on a 6-0 run in the next two minutes and eventually whittled the lead down to 10 points with just under 12 minutes to go.  But the momentum shifted once again less than two minutes later, and the Twins again found themselves leading by 19 points.  Jaden Edwards and Tydrea Rodriguez led the charge, along with some sharp shooting by Sawyer Spohler and Jon-Taylor Elmendorf.  With the offense staying hot, CG-CC was able to push their lead up to as many as 28 points  with three minutes remaining in the game.  " I was very happy with our defense to start the second half.  We got a big jolt from Jaden and Tydrea," said Rickard.  "I was very happy with our overall effort.  It was a great team win."

Tydrea Rodriguez finished the game with 28 points and eight rebounds.  Jaden Edwards netted a season-high 23 points.  Rounding out the top scorers was Sawyer Spohler, who finished with 18.

The Twins improve their record to 15-11 overall, 11-11 in Region 3 and 9-6 in the MVC.

On Saturday, C-GCC takes on nationally ranked  #2 Herkimer CCC at home.  Tip-off will be at 1:00pm
